We spoke at the Planning Committee to voice our concerns on the plans for North Herts College in the town centre. The Committee shared our concerns and has required indoor cycle parking to be provided. We'll continue to campaign for safe and convenient cycling routes to the town centre! 💪

Around 50 cyclists enjoyed perfect weather for our Midsummer Cycling for ALL last weekend. Our route was entirely traffic-free - incl. the new Gresley Way cycleway linking Fairlands Way and Six Hills Way. This new cycleway has been made possible thanks to active campaigning from our volunteers 💪🙏

More Good News! For at least 3 years, the underpass under the entrance to the lcon building has had no lighting. We have been campaigning to Hill & @hertscc.bsky.social for years. We'll continue to campaign for permanent lights but the temporary fix of motion sensitive LED lights is very welcome 🙏

Good News! After a long absence, there are cycle racks outside the main entrance of big Tesco in town again! There are now 12, more than before. We had explained to the Council that people using the racks needed easy, direct access from the cycleway and convenient parking near the store entrance.
